From the globe’s highest structure to the inmost diving swimming pool, the United Arab Emirates, which transforms 50 on Thursday, has a love of establishing documents.
Right here are 5 of the rich Gulf state’s record-breaking tasks:
Dubai’s radiating success is the needle-shaped Burj Khalifa, the globe’s highest structure.
The 828-metre (2,717-feet) high-rise building, in glimmering glass as well as steel, opened up in the midtown location in 2010.
Referred To As Burj Dubai prior to its launch, it was relabelled Burj Khalifa in honour of UAE’s Head of state His Highness Sheikh Khalifa container Zayed Al Nahyan.
The globe’s biggest Ferris wheel, Ain Dubai, opened up in October 2021.
At 250 metres (820 feet) from the ground to the top of its edge, Ain Dubai (” Dubai Eye”) towers over the Bluewaters synthetic island.
Each of its 48 carriages can hold 40 individuals, as well as it takes 38 mins to finish a complete turning.
Dubai is not the only emirate with record-breaking frameworks, with Ras Al-Khaimah flaunting the globe’s lengthiest zipline.
Jebel Jais Trip, which opened up in January 2018, covers 2,831.88 metres (9,290 feet).
Motorcyclists can get to accelerate to 150 kilometres (93 miles) per hr as they zoom with the Hajar range of mountains.
Dubai included in its listing of documents in June when it opened up the globe’s inmost swimming pool for diving.
Deep Dive Dubai, an interior center for diving, plumbs 60 metres (196 feet). Scuba divers can check out a simulated sunken city, play chess as well as browse with caverns.
Abu Dhabi, the UAE resources, additionally has its share of documents consisting of the globe’s fastest rollercoaster.
Solution Rossa, which mimics driving a Solution One auto at a rate of as much as 240 kilometres (150 miles) a hr, lies at the Ferrari Globe amusement park as well as opened up in November 2010.
